You learn the Dutch language on the civic integration course and learn about working and living in the Netherlands.

In the Netherlands you can integrate in 2 ways. This can be done through the civic integration exam or the Staatsexamen Dutch as a second language (NT2). Most people who are subject to civic integration in the Netherlands do the civic integration examination.

If you have learned enough on the civic integration course you can take an exam. The civic integration examination consists of the components writing, speaking, listening, reading, knowledge of Dutch society and orientation Dutch labor market. In the Netherlands you can take the civic integration exam in Amsterdam, Eindhoven, Rijswijk, Rotterdam and Zwolle.

 

Civic Integration Schools

 

If you are going to integrate, choose a school that provides recognized integration courses. Always ask whether the school possesses the 'Certification Quality Mark' from the Dutch government. You can also check on the website of the Education Executive Agency (DUO) whether the school is a recognized institute. If the school has the 'Integration quality mark' then you can apply for a loan from DUO for the integration course. The school will also assist you with the application for the loan.

Some integration schools have fixed start dates and others can start the civic integration course when it suits you best.
